网上书店源代码:构建高效安全购书系统

需积分: 9 3 下载量 61 浏览量 更新于2024-09-20 1 收藏 476B TXT 举报
"该资源提供的是一个功能完善的网上书店源代码,适用于开发在线购书平台。此系统在Windows XP/7操作系统上运行,利用MySQL作为数据库存储,采用JDK 1.6作为开发环境,JSP服务器是Tomcat 6.0,开发工具是MyEclipse 9.0,且推荐360浏览器进行浏览。" 这个网上书店源代码的设计与实现涵盖了网上购书系统的多个关键功能模块,以下将详细解释这些功能: 1. 用户管理模块:系统支持用户注册和登录,确保用户信息安全,同时提供忘记密码的功能,帮助用户找回账户。用户注册时需要验证邮箱或手机号,确保账号的真实性。 2. 商品展示与搜索:系统能够展示书籍的详细信息,包括封面、作者、出版社、价格等,用户可以通过关键词、分类等方式快速查找所需书籍。 3. 购物车与订单处理:用户可以将选中的书籍添加到购物车,实现商品的临时存储。在结算时,系统会生成订单,记录购买的商品信息、数量及总价,同时提供多种支付方式供用户选择。 4. 物流跟踪:系统能追踪订单的物流状态,用户可以查询订单的发货、运输和配送进度,提高购物体验。 5. 评论与评价:用户购买书籍后,可以对商品进行评价,分享购书心得,提供其他用户参考。系统会根据用户的评价进行统计,以展示商品的平均评分。 6. 消息通知:系统具备消息推送功能,用户可以收到订单状态变更、促销活动等通知,确保及时了解相关信息。 7. 安全性与稳定性:系统设计时考虑了数据的高效性和安全性,采用合适的加密技术保护用户隐私,同时通过优化代码和数据库设计确保系统在高并发访问下仍能稳定运行。 这个源代码对于学习JSP、Servlet、MySQL以及Java Web开发的学生或开发者来说,是一个很好的实践项目,可以帮助他们理解如何构建一个完整的电子商务网站。通过实际操作,开发者可以掌握如何整合前端界面、后端逻辑和数据库操作,提升自己的开发技能。此外,此系统还具有一定的可扩展性,可以根据需求添加新的功能或优化现有模块。